55-75k is a good range. Don’t worry about what others are earning as this won’t change as u reach ur 30s too.

Maybe u will be earning 120-150k in ur 30s and when u come here u will see .. people saying they earn 300k or 400k ..

If u earn 200-300k u will see people earning 600k-700k ..

If u earn 600-700k .. u will see people are earning 1.2 million LOL.

It just doesn’t stop. So don’t compare. Just letting u know from personal exp. it just is non stop and never ending.

At 26 I earned around 67k
At 29 I joined google so now I am 200-220k But it really doesn’t matter. Just keep doing what u like .. concentrate on ur life .. ur happiness .. travel etc. ❤️💪.. don’t compare. Hope this helps.

The smartest thing you can do at your age is to focus more on how much you can save/invest rather than how much you can earn and spend. If someone makes 50k and invests $1000 per month and another person makes 200k and invests $700 a month the person who invests more is going to be better off in the long run.

Live below your means and invest like crazy.
